TaskForest::Options - Get options from command line and/or environment
use TaskForest::Options; my $o = &TaskForest::Options::getOptions(); # the above command will die if required options are not present

This is a convenience class that gets the required and optional command line parameters, and uses environment variables if command line parameters are not specified.
Usage : my $config = &TaskForest::Options::getConfig($file) Purpose : This method reads a config file Returns : A hash ref of the options specified in the config file Argument : The name of the config file Throws : Nothing
Usage : my $options = &TaskForest::Options::getOptions
Purpose : This method returns a list of all the options passed
in.
Returns : A hash ref of the options
Argument : None
Throws : "The following required options are missing"
Various exceptions if the parameters passed in are of
the wrong format.
Usage : showHelp() Purpose : This method prints help text Returns : Nothing Argument : None Throws : Nothing

# ------------------------------------------------------------------------------ sub showHelp { print qq^ USAGE To run the main taskforest dependency checker, do one of the following: export TF_JOB_DIR=/foo/jobs export TF_LOG_DIR=/foo/logs export TF_FAMILY_DIR=/foo/families export TF_RUN_WRAPPER=/foo/bin/run taskforest OR taskforest --run_wrapper=/foo/bin/run \ --log_dir=/foo/logs \ --job_dir=/foo/jobs \ --family_dir=/foo/families OR taskforest --config_file=taskforest.cfg All jobs will run as the user who invoked taskforest. To get the status of all currently running and recently run jobs, enter the following command: status --collapse For more detailed documentation, enter: man TaskForest or perldoc TaskForest ^; } 1
